I have a big head. And ALOT of curly hair. I am often running out of hair products, and so I have learned the value of making my own when I’ve run out. Deep conditioner has always been the tricky one to make, since a lot of the DIYs around use egg, mayonnaise or other animal products. My recipe is vegan-friendly and doesn’t require blending or straining like others that call for banana or avocado. Cheers! Scroll down to make your own deep conditioner.

How to make

  1. To your mixing bowl, get ready to add:
  2. 3 tablespoons of Mayonnaise, followed by 1 tablespoon of Olive oil
  3. Then add 1 teaspoon of Vegetable glycerin
  4. Next, add 5 drops each of Lavender and Rosemary essential oils
  5. Mix to combine until smooth
  6. Add to your air-tight container
  7. All done!

Ways to use

  • Apply generously to freshly washed or co-washed hair in sections
  • Leave in for 1 hour
  • Rinse out completely with warm water
  • Moisturize with this and this when you’re done!
  • This recipe makes enough for one application for me and my large head of hair
  • Refrigerate any leftovers
